Ensuring Establishment And Survival Of Young Urban Trees
The initial years following planting are the most critical period for any tree's survival, and for urban forestry projects in Manchester, this vulnerability is intensified by harsh city conditions. Young trees lack the expansive root systems necessary to draw sufficient moisture from compacted, shallow urban soils, making consistent, measured watering vital. Professional irrigation system installation ensures that newly planted trees receive precisely the right amount of water during this establishment phase, preventing the common pitfalls of dehydration or overwatering. This precision provided by the irrigation system installation is the difference between a tree thriving and becoming another costly failure in the city's urban forestry plan.
In the dense, built-up environment of Manchester, manual watering methods are often impractical, inconsistent, and highly wasteful. A professionally designed irrigation system installation uses deep-root watering technology, such as bubblers or subsurface drip lines, which deliver water directly to the root zone, circumventing competition from surrounding turf or pavement. This focused application minimizes evaporation and ensures that the scarce resource is used entirely to benefit the urban forestry effort. The ability of a dedicated irrigation system installation to provide this continuous, targeted support is paramount for protecting the substantial public or private investment made in new trees across Manchester.
An irrigation system installation is not a one-size-fits-all solution; it must be calibrated to the specific microclimates and species within the urban forestry project. Different tree species, as well as varied sun exposure across a single site in Manchester, require varying water quantities and schedules. Modern irrigation system installation includes smart controllers that automatically adjust watering based on weather data and seasonal needs. This sophisticated management ensures maximum efficiency, guaranteeing that every young tree has the optimal conditions to establish a strong, resilient root structure, thereby securing its role in the long-term urban forestry vision.

Protecting Public Infrastructure And Reducing Maintenance Costs
While the primary benefit of irrigation system installation is the health of the urban forestry assets, a key operational advantage is its role in protecting public infrastructure and reducing long-term maintenance costs in Manchester. Traditional watering methods, such as surface flooding or hose-pipe application, often lead to water runoff, which can erode topsoil, damage pavements, and overload drainage systems. A well-designed irrigation system installation, particularly one using subsurface delivery, eliminates surface runoff.
By delivering water directly beneath the surface, a quality irrigation system installation mitigates root-related infrastructure damage. Trees that struggle for water often extend their roots horizontally just beneath the paving to find moisture, leading to cracked sidewalks and damaged utilities. Consistent, deep watering facilitated by the irrigation system installation encourages roots to grow downward, away from the surface infrastructure. This proactive measure saves Manchester and property owners significant capital expenditure on pavement repair and utility work caused by unruly, shallow-rooted trees, directly contributing to the economic sustainability of urban forestry.
